Re: service brake system (wont start?)help

Sounds like a failed ignition switch. Very common on the GMT360 chassis. You get funky dash lights and a no start condition from this. The switch is attached to the key barrel in the steering column. I have not had to touch one yet, so I don't exactly how to R/R it. I know of atleast one report of an owner removing the switch and cleaning the contacts. It worked for him. This switch is yet another cut-rate GM electrical component.
